    Thanks for the Uthalesh warning. I've been running it as Destro with Infernal. He can pull things around corners when I want to clear a room safely. Very handy.

    The Volatile wraiths cast Unstable Explosion at low health. It will go off no matter how fast you kill them and always hurts the Withered somewhat. I read that interrupts don't work on this, only stuns, so I've been using the Infernal stun or Shadowfury. I'd much rather be casting Fear or Banish to stop the Unstable Explosion if that works. Does Fear or Banish work on Unstable Explosion?

    I finally completed the entire scenario today with no issues - and when I say no issues I mean this run I had no issues. I've been progressively collecting the one-time 10-withered and 5-withered chests for the last few runs without even attempting the spider gauntlet as I found it to be a pain on Beta without good gear and withered upgrades.

    Today when I went in I only had the chest beyond the spider gauntlet to collect (meaning I had 2 Berserkers, 2 Mana-Ragers, 1 Starcaller, 25% increased HP, 25% increased damage and reduced run away buff) and so was able to attempt clearing with the maximum possible upgrades. Although you can most certainly complete it without the maximum upgrades, I'd definitely recommend doing this for ease of completion. I completed the majority of the scenario as ST Demo, but switched to AoE Destro for the gauntlet. My iLvl is 848 (no legendaries).

    For the bulk of the scenario I was Demo with talents 1222322. Nothing special about the choices but you should really choose Mortal Coil over Demon Skin for the extra CC. Obviously you should start with 20 withered (2k mana). For the trash mobs before the spider gauntlet, there are only a couple of scary ones. The first are the big Arcane elementals, just make sure you always have the Felguard stun and Mortal Coil available for them. Use one whenever they start casting (they shouldn't be able to cast more than twice with 20+ withered). The elite spiders next to the Volatile Wraithlord rare can be very dangerous if you pull more than 2, so you really need to take it slow and cautious here, but when facing only one, they're no problem.

    Lapillia was a non-issue - just pop CDs, withered buff and burn the boss down whilst using Felguard stun, Grimoire stun and Mortal Coil at the first sign of any Crystalline Shrapnel cast. You can also use the Infernal for a 3rd stun but it doesn't really matter on this rare so Doomguard is better. If you do get the shrapnel debuff just run away from your withered.

    Leystalker Dro's main problem is the unpredictability of where he will spawn. If he spawns when you're fighting an Arcane elemental you can get overwhelmed very quickly or run out of CCs. Take it real slow until he spawns, there's not much else you can do. Also break the Webs after you've cleared the trash around them as he seems to sometimes spawn from those. If you spawn him alone he's not that much of a threat if you do things perfect. Pop withered buff and start nuking, try to get as many pets out as possible and he can charge them instead of the withered if you're lucky. Felguard stun when he charges once, first. The second time he charges use the Grimoire stun, third use the Infernal for its stun. Finally use Mortal Coil for the fourth. You shouldn't get a fifth charge as he should be dying around this time. If you're unlucky you will lose 4 withered max, if you're lucky and on-the-ball you can get away without losing any.

    After Dro, you should go for the Brood Guardian Phyx. He's the easiest and poses no real danger and you can usually pick up 3-4 extra withered in his room. Like with the first rare, just CC casts and let your withered buff burn him down.

    Next is the Volatile Wraithlord. This guy is just a suped-up version of the Arcane elementals and so the same principles apply. Just be careful not to pull any of the elite spider adds with him. I recommend killing the first big spider add right in front of you as you enter the room, then pull the boss right back into the corridor, pop withered buff, Felguard stun the first cast, Grimoire stun the second, Infernal the third and Mortal Coil the forth if needed. He should be dead long before he gets to a fifth cast.

    The mini-spider rare (can't remember its name) that you need to kill to open the door before Furog the Elfbreaker can just be pulled out of the room and killed. There is literally no need to actually enter the room unless you reeeeeeally want those extra 1-2 withered. The eggs/spiders can do a lot of damage if you aggro them, and can be a pain to gather-up and AoE. Plus they give no points, so if you can ignore them you should. You can sneak around the eggs without breaking them to get those extra withered, but its risky.

    Furog the Elfbreaker can be pulled out of his room to avoid the barrage of spiders from the gauntlet. His main risky move is his AoE stomp. This NEEDs to be interrupted with CC. Tbh, I'd just ignore the Grab Withered casts and solely use CC for the stomp - the reason being is that you may run out of CCs if you interrupt both and the cast time of the grab gives you more time to burn him down, meaning less stomps overall.

    After this dude I changed to Destro with talents 3212313. I used the Infernal for its pulsing AoE aggro (although its not really that great). I just ran up the first set of stairs whilst telling my Infernal to attack every spider in front of me. Once here, I Cata'd and spammed AoE-Incinerate until all the spiders were dead, ignore the withered here you don't need them and it wastes time. Run to the top of the stairs and pull Psillych. Use the infernal's stun straight away to spawn the extra 3 infernals from the artifact trait (which I'm assuming everyone has). Now just blow everything you have. Nothing special here - the aim is to just kill him before you/your withered die.

    And GG you're done. Hopefully this helped those still looking for strats or help. The final chest gives your withered more accuracy when DPSing for next run, which should make things easier. Good luck.
